Course description

Dietary patterns are one of several potentially modifiable factors that influence cardiometabolic health and chronic-disease risk. This 1.0-contact-hour activity equips physicians, physician assistants, advanced practice registered nurses, registered nurses, and registered dietitian nutritionists to assess dietary patterns; explain current evidence about ultra-processed foods and selected additives; and apply evidence-based dietary guidance, brief counseling, and referral strategies in routine practice.

Obesity affects more than 40% of U.S. adults and approximately 20% of children and adolescents, and the incidence of several early-onset cancers has increased. Dietary patterns are potentially modifiable contributors within a broader set of genetic, metabolic, environmental, social, and behavioral factors. Many clinicians report limited nutrition training, and emerging state continuing-education requirements further support the need for practical, evidence-based nutrition competency (Albin et al., 2024; GBD 2021 US Obesity Forecasting Collaborators [GBD], 2024; Zhao et al., 2023).
